Beautiful and Moving Film
ronaldevan20 January 2024
I loved the amalgamation of the beautiful camera shots, talented cast, and story line that was equal parts, sexy, funny, and endearing. By the end of the movie, you'll identify with one of the characters struggles, as well as yearn to live in the dreamy beach house. It's not at all a thriller, but still leaves you holding your breath, and bitting your nails at certain points. The whole production feels very reminiscent of Tom Ford's movies to me. Every scene, sound, movement, and lighting change is a vibe. This is a newer director for me, but after watching The Shoulder Dance, I want to check out more of Jay Arnold's films. Go watch! This was the perfect move to laugh, cry, and think fondly of yesterday. :)

Refreshingly real and authentically entertaining movie
emrphila29 January 2024
This well produced and directed movie entertains in a big way....the story not only allowed me to reminisce about my party days (which was one of my happiest chapters of my life), but tells a compelling story of childhood friends.

"Love, Laughter, and Friendship shine in this heartwarming film that beautifully explores the deep bond between two friends. The story not only celebrates the joy of self-discovery, but also highlights the enduring power of genuine connections. With stellar performances and a touching narrative, this movie is a testament to the universal themes of love and acceptance that resonate beyond boundaries."

A refreshingly real and well written movie, perfectly casted. It's not surprising this movie is getting the attention it deserves. Wonderful film that shouldn't be missed.
